SHRM 2011 Annual Conference
 

Join Deb Cohen, Ph.D., SHRM’s Chief Knowledge Officer, as she moderates this discussion between two highly successful senior HR executives. Kyle Jensen, Talent Scout, New Belgium Brewing Company Kyle Jensen currently holds the position of Talent Scout at New Belgium Brewing Company where he serves as the in-house recruiter for the Human Resources Department. New Belgium Brewing Company, makers of Fat Amber Ale and other Belgian-inspired beers, began operations in a tiny Fort Collins basement in 1991. Today, the third largest craft brewer in the U.S., New Belgium produces seven year-round beers. Mary K. W. Jones, Vice President, Global Human Resources, Deere & Company Jones joined Deere & Company in 1997 as an attorney and was named Director, Human Resources Global and Regional Deployment in May 2009. Deere & Company is a world leader in providing advanced products and services and is committed to the success of its customers.

Debra Cohen, PhD, SPHR, is the chief knowledge development and integration officer for the Society for Human Resource Management (SHRM) and is responsible for the Society’s Knowledge Development and Integration Division, which includes the SHRM Knowledge Center (including the Society Library), the Research Department, Academic Initiatives, and HR Standards. Dr. Cohen joined SHRM in May of 2000 as the director of Research. Prior to joining SHRM, Dr. Cohen spent 15 years as an academician teaching HRM at George Washington University (10 years) and George Mason University (5 years). Dr. Cohen has published over 40 articles and book chapters and has been published in several journals. Dr. Cohen received her PhD in management and human resources in 1987 and her master’s degree in labor and human resources (MLHR) in 1982, both from The Ohio State University. She received her bachelor of science (in communications) from Ohio University. She is a frequent presenter at national, international, and regional conferences and has spoken to a wide variety of audiences. Prior to her academic career, she was a practicing human resources manager (in Training and Development).

Kyle currently holds the position of Talent Scout at New Belgium Brewing Company where he serves as the in-house recruiter for the Human Resources Department. He has been with New Belgium since March of 2002 where he has held numerous positions within production, purchasing, and Human Resources. Kyle also participates in the many committees offered at the brewery including our Employee Ownership group where he has served as Vice Chair representing New Belgium at various ESOP (Employee Stock Option Program) events. Prior to joining New Belgium he worked as a vendor supplier rep within the packaging raw materials industry. His education includes a Bachelor of Arts degree in the field of Speech Communication from Indiana University Bloomington. Mary K. W. Jones is Vice President, Global Human Resources for Deere & Company. Jones is responsible for leading the Global Human Resources organization.

After working in private practice, Jones joined Deere & Company in 1997 as an attorney. She served in Global Law Services for over ten years in roles as senior attorney, senior counsel, assistant general counsel and associate general counsel. In March 2008 she was appointed Corporate Secretary and Associate General Counsel, Deere & Company. In October 2008, Jones joined the company's Corporate Human Resources organization as Director, Regional Human Resources and Shared Services. Prior to her current position, she was named Director, Human Resources Global and Regional Deployment in May 2009.

A native of Cordova, Illinois, Jones received her bachelor's degree from Truman State University. She received her juris doctor degree, with high distinction, from the University of Iowa College of Law, where she was a member of the editorial board of the Iowa Law Review.

Jones is a member of the Illinois and Iowa Bar Associations. She is a member and previously has served as Chair of the Corporate Law Departments Section Council of the Illinois State Bar Association. She also is a member of the Association of Corporate Counsel. Jones serves on the Board of Directors of the Deere Employees Credit Union and on the regional Board of Directors of the March of Dimes. She has previously been a member of the Board of Directors of the Learning Campus Foundation, Edgerton Women's Health Center, and the Family Museum, where she served as Chairman of the Board.
